NEW DELHI, JUNE 2 : To commemorate World Food Safety Day on 7th June, the National Institute of Food Technology Entrepreneurship and Management, Kundli (NIFTEM-K), held a two-day certificate course on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P) from 1st-2nd June 2024.

The course, conducted in collaboration with The Acheson Group, attracted students and professionals from various organisations.

Dr. Harinder Singh Oberoi, Director of NIFTEM-K, inaugurated the event, emphasising the importance of stringent food safety protocols. Ranjeet Klair from The Acheson Group led the sessions, offering hands-on learning through interactive exercises and role-playing scenarios.

The programme aimed to enhance practical knowledge in food safety management, demonstrating NIFTEM-K’s commitment to excellence in education and industry partnership.(UNI)
